New Precision Orbits of Bright Double-lined Spectroscopic Binaries. X. HD 96511, HR 7578, and KZ Andromedae
Henry, Gregory W.; Fekel, Francis C.; Tomkin, Jocelyn
From an extensive number of newly acquired radial velocities we determine the orbital elements for three late-type dwarf systems, HD 96511, HR 7578, and KZ And. The orbital periods are 18.89737 ± 0.00002, 46.81610 ± 0.00006, and 3.0329113 ± 0.0000005 days, respectively, and all three systems are eccentric, although KZ And is just barely so. We hav…

Hubble Space Telescope Ultraviolet Light Curves Reveal Interesting Properties of CC Sculptoris and RZ Leonis
Szkody, Paula; Sion, Edward M.; Godon, Patrick +6 more
Time-tag ultraviolet data obtained on the Hubble Space Telescope in 2013 reveal interesting variability related to the white dwarf spin in the two cataclysmic variables RZ Leo and CC Scl. RZ Leo shows a period at 220 s and its harmonic at 110 s, thus identifying it as a likely Intermediate Polar (IP). The spin signal is not visible in a short sing…

FUSE Spectroscopy of the Accreting Hot Components in Symbiotic Variables
Sion, Edward M.; Godon, Patrick; Mikolajewska, Joanna +2 more
We have conducted a spectroscopic analysis of the far-ultraviolet archival spectra of four symbiotic variables, EG And, AE Ara, CQ Dra, and RW Hya. RW Hya and EG And have never had a recorded outburst, while CQ Dra and AE Ara have outburst histories. New Horizons Upper Limits on O2 in Pluto’s Present Day Atmosphere
Stern, S. A.; Olkin, C. B.; Weaver, H. A. +7 more
The surprising discovery by the Rosetta spacecraft of molecular oxygen (O2) in the coma of comet 67P/Churyumov-Gerasimenko challenged our understanding of the inventory of this volatile species on and inside bodies from the Kuiper Belt. Estimating Spectra from Photometry
Connolly, Andrew J.; Kalmbach, J. Bryce
Measuring the physical properties of galaxies such as redshift frequently requires the use of spectral energy distributions (SEDs). SED template sets are, however, often small in number and cover limited portions of photometric color space.
